The Power of Smart Thermostats at Home
Smart thermostats are moving beyond being a tech novelty. These devices adjust the temperature based on patterns and preferences to create a tailored environment. What makes a smart thermostat stand out is its ability to learn routines. Over time, it picks up on when everyone leaves, arrives, or sleeps. Many households find that this learning feature provides greater comfort and reliable temperature control throughout mornings and evenings. Integrating a smart thermostat also means connecting it to other devices. Voice assistants, smartphones, and home security systems can work in tandem for even more convenience.
One major advantage concerns energy use. Smart thermostats optimize heating and cooling cycles, only using energy when needed. For example, when the house is empty, the system reduces unnecessary heating or cooling. Automating these adjustments can significantly cut energy consumption and, in turn, lower monthly utility costs. It’s more than just efficiency; it’s about maintaining a pleasant home while being mindful of the environment. Some users report seeing changes in their bills within the first few weeks of setup. Major energy agencies highlight that such technology plays a key role in reducing peak energy demand (Source: https://www.energy.gov/energysaver/programmable-thermostats).
The user interface is another reason this technology is gaining popularity. Large, clear displays and user-friendly apps allow homeowners to track their energy savings, set schedules, and even receive alerts for unusual activity. Instead of guessing whether the HVAC system is running efficiently, smart thermostats provide data and insights that can help households take control. For renters or homeowners, these interfaces can be a helpful guide in maintaining a comfortable, cost-effective living space.
Cost Savings and Affordability Factors
One of the greatest appeals of smart thermostats is their potential to lower utility bills. By optimizing energy use, households may notice a reduction in expenses. Unlike traditional thermostats, which rely on manual adjustments, smart devices anticipate needs. As the system adapts to unique schedules, unnecessary heating or cooling is avoided. This precision saves both money and energy, a significant advantage for budget-conscious families. According to government studies, programmable thermostats can yield considerable annual savings under realistic usage (Source: https://www.energystar.gov/products/heating_cooling/smart_thermostats).
Rebates and incentives from utility companies also factor into affordability. Many energy providers encourage adoption of smart thermostats with financial rewards or rebates. These incentives help offset initial costs, making the technology more accessible. Exploring these programs can ease concerns about the upfront investment required for smart home upgrades. Households interested in sustainable living or those seeking ways to manage a tight budget may find that the cost is quickly offset by the combination of lower monthly bills and rebate opportunities. Local governments and utility companies frequently update their incentive offerings, so checking recent listings can make a difference.
The long-term value rests not only in individual savings but also in broader efficiency. Smart thermostats have been linked to overall household energy use reduction, which has positive implications for neighborhoods and the environment. States and municipalities measure these aggregate benefits, encouraging community-wide participation. A single smart thermostat can make a measurable difference over the course of several years, leading many homeowners to view it as a worthwhile investment with both personal and societal returns.
Key Features Driving Efficiency and Comfort
Smart thermostats come equipped with a range of features designed to maximize comfort and energy savings. Geofencing uses a smartphone’s location to determine whether the house is occupied. If everyone leaves, the thermostat sets itself to an energy-saving mode automatically. This type of automation allows for greater efficiency without demanding constant user attention. Sensors that detect temperature and humidity in different rooms can help close gaps in comfort, ensuring the right climate throughout the house. For large or multi-story homes, these sensors can make a noticeable difference in how evenly each area is heated or cooled.
Remote control capabilities are another major advantage. Users can adjust their thermostat from anywhere using a mobile app, whether at work or on vacation. This feature proves useful when schedules change unexpectedly. Forgot to turn down the heat before leaving? The app allows swift corrections on the go. Scheduled settings, vacation modes, and even weather-responsive adjustments are standard across many devices. Some systems can receive software updates, which open new features and further improve performance over time. This adaptability ensures devices remain future-proof and relevant.
Data reporting and energy consumption tracking empower homeowners to understand how their habits influence utility costs. Many smart thermostats generate weekly or monthly reports that break down how and when energy is used. Users can analyze these trends and adjust behaviors if desired. This transparency is a powerful motivator in energy-conscious households. Clear feedback helps encourage sustainable habits, aligning personal goals with environmental objectives. For households interested in eco-friendly lifestyles, these insights offer tangible steps toward greater efficiency every month (Source: https://www.epa.gov/energy/home-energy-audits).
Installation Tips and Compatibility Checks
Many smart thermostats are designed for straightforward installation, but checking compatibility is crucial. Different HVAC systems may have unique wiring or requirements. Most manufacturers offer compatibility checkers online or through customer support. Before purchase, double-checking ensures the right fit for any home’s setup. The installation process often involves turning off power, labeling wires, and connecting the new device. Comprehensive guides—sometimes with videos—help reduce confusion. For those less comfortable with electrical work, professional installation is always an option (Source: https://www.consumerreports.org/appliances/thermostats/how-to-install-a-smart-thermostat-a1610498108/).
Ensuring Wi-Fi strength is another important consideration. Smart thermostats rely on Wi-Fi to enable remote controls and updates. A strong and consistent wireless signal at the installation site helps avoid connection issues. Homes with multiple floors or thick walls may benefit from Wi-Fi extenders to guarantee reliability. Integrating the thermostat with existing home automation devices is often as simple as using the app or following pairing instructions. Households that already use smart home hubs usually enjoy a seamless connection process. However, reading through manufacturer-specific instructions can prevent unnecessary troubleshooting and ensure a smoother setup.
Regular software updates keep devices running securely and efficiently. Setting up automatic updates, if available, is recommended. This ensures the thermostat receives the latest features and security patches. Periodically reviewing connection strength and battery status (for models that use batteries) ensures uninterrupted performance. With a bit of planning and some attention to details during setup, smart thermostats quickly become a low-maintenance part of daily life. Installation is often a one-time project, with ongoing benefits that last for years.
Integrating With Broader Home Automation
Smart thermostats can be integrated with a wider suite of home automation devices, providing a unified smart home experience. When connected to systems such as lighting, security cameras, or smart locks, thermostats can adjust temperature based on more than schedules alone. For example, a home security system that detects absence can trigger the thermostat to switch to energy-saving mode. Lights can also be programmed to turn off or dim when the temperature adjusts for nighttime comfort. This level of integration creates a more coordinated, intelligent home environment.
Voice control is another advantage. Many smart thermostats are compatible with popular voice assistants. This allows homeowners to adjust settings hands-free, simply by asking. For those with mobility challenges or busy households, this convenience makes daily life run more smoothly. Over time, voice assistants may learn preferred settings, further customizing the experience. Integrating these features can encourage sustainable use of all connected devices, making the entire system more effective and intuitive.
Security and privacy are important considerations. Manufacturers continuously improve encryption standards to protect user data and devices from potential threats. Keeping software updated minimizes risks. Reading privacy policies provides insight into how data is handled. Homeowners seeking further assurance can separate their smart home devices onto a dedicated Wi-Fi network. This proactive step can secure connected thermostats and ensure peace of mind—allowing full advantage of smart technology while safeguarding personal information (Source: https://www.consumer.ftc.gov/articles/how-secure-your-home-wi-fi-network).
Troubleshooting, Maintenance, and Final Insights
Like other electronics, smart thermostats occasionally require troubleshooting. Common issues include Wi-Fi disconnections or inaccurate temperature readings. Most manufacturers offer detailed support, either through in-app tips or help centers. Restarting the device, checking batteries, or resetting the Wi-Fi connection resolve most minor errors. Tracking and resolving alerts through the app or online support minimizes time spent on maintenance. Proactive attention pays off, keeping the thermostat functioning as intended.
Routine maintenance is simple. For models with batteries, changing them once or twice a year is often enough. Cleaning the device surface prevents dust accumulation, which can interfere with temperature readings. For advanced users or those who integrate with more complex HVAC systems, consulting with service professionals periodically can ensure optimal performance. Smart thermostats also provide reminders for filter replacements or regular HVAC servicing, helping safeguard system health and longevity. These proactive tips keep everything running smoothly.
